In this week’s Global COVID-19 Wrap, SABC News captures highlights from all corners of the globe, as the number of confirmed infections worldwide continue to rise.

Currently, the COVID-19 cases worldwide stand at over 36.7 million with more than 27 million recoveries and deaths at 1 066 956.

In South Africa, the number of confirmed cases surpassed the 686 000 mark. Whilst the death toll has risen to 17 408.

On the rest of the continent, 52 African Union Member States have so far reported 1 556 017 cases; with 37 452 deaths and 1 292 200 recoveries.
